What is the first step in writing an effective business report?

Formulate questions and set the purpose of your business report. Formulating questions and goals will help you know which and what kind of information should be included in the report. This is the first and crucial step, and this makes the remaining steps of writing business reports a lot easier.

What is the general purpose of creating a formal report?

The general purpose of a formal report is to provide information to stakeholders and decision-makers to make decisions. Reports can be purely informational or analytical. Informational reports provide information. Analytical reports provide opinions and recommendations to decision-makers.

What is procedure in report writing?

Procedures are action oriented. They outline steps to take, and the order in which they need to be taken. They’re often instructional, and they may be used in training and orientation. Well-written procedures are typically solid, precise, factual, short, and to the point.
